Q.

If polythene sample contains two monodisperse fractions in the ratio 2: 3with degree of polymerization 100 and 200. Respectively. Then its weight average molecular weight will be

Degree of polymerization of 1 polymer=100
Degree of polymerization of II polymer=200 N 1 =2: N 2 =3   Molar mass of monomer (ethylene) of polythene=28g/mol
Now, degree of polymerization is given as DP=  Molar mass of monomer   Molar mass of polymer   
Thus, Molar mass of I polymer M 1 =100×28=2800g/mol  
Molar mass of II polymer M 2 =200×28=5600g/mol  
Now, the weight average molecular weight is given as: M w = n i M i 2 n i Mi  
M w = n i M 1 2 + n 2 M 2 2 n 1 M 1 + n 2 M 2 = 2 (2800) 2 +3 (5600) 2 2×2800+3×5600 =4900g/mol
